Summary

On February 11, 2020, at approximately 11:10 AM, the vicinity of West 54th Street and 9th Avenue in Manhattan, [redacted] drove a yellow Nissan Nv-200 taxi cab. [redacted] waited at a traffic light behind two additional vehicles. When the light turned green, [redacted] continued to drive. At this time, Police Officer Jonathan Acquaviva of the 18th Precinct pulled [redacted] over. PO Acquaviva approached [redacted] and told [redacted] that he made an improper turn at the traffic light. PO Acquaviva requested [redacted] ID and told him that he will be issued a summons. PO Acquaviva went back to his vehicle. When PO Acquaviva returned with [redacted] documents and Summons #[redacted] (Board Review 14), for making an improper turn, [redacted] disputed that he made an improper turn at the traffic light. [redacted] pointed his finger at PO Acquaviva's face and called PO Acquaviva "a piece of shit". PO Acquaviva punched [redacted] hand away (Allegation A: Force, [redacted] PO Acquaviva asked for [redacted] ID for a second time. [redacted] refused. [redacted] told PO Acquaviva that he will file a complaint against him. PO Acquaviva returned to his vehicle and issued [redacted] Summons #[redacted] (Board Review 14), for failing to comply to lawful order (Allegation B: Abuse of Authority- Retaliatory Summons, [redacted] PO Acquaviva told [redacted] that if he exited his vehicle, PO Acquaviva will use his Taser on him (Allegation C: Abuse of Authority- Threat of Force, [redacted] was not arrested or injured as of result of this incident.
